

Juniper vSRX and WatchGuard Firebox are key players in network security solutions. Juniper vSRX has the upper hand in advanced security features and high performance under heavy traffic, while WatchGuard Firebox is superior in user-friendliness and ease of management.
Features: Juniper vSRX is known for its advanced security functions such as IDS/IPS and traffic configuration, as well as virtualization that supports flexible deployment. WatchGuard Firebox stands out with Application Control, VPN support, and content filtering, offering an intuitive interface that simplifies management.
Room for Improvement: Juniper vSRX could improve its GUI and address hardware-software integration complexities, as well as enhance stability. WatchGuard Firebox could benefit from better reporting capabilities and deeper third-party integration, as well as a more intuitive GUI and improved cloud management features.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Both Juniper vSRX and WatchGuard Firebox provide diverse deployment options including private, public, and hybrid clouds. Juniper vSRX is recognized for responsive technical support, while WatchGuard Firebox receives mixed reviews on support efficiency.
Pricing and ROI: Juniper vSRX offers reasonable pricing with strong ROI, though it tends to be costlier than some alternatives. WatchGuard Firebox is praised for its competitive pricing, especially benefiting SMBs with long-term license discounts enhancing its cost-effectiveness.

Juniper vSRX is ideal for network security, offering scalable solutions for high-traffic environments and supporting comprehensive VPNs. Its easy setup, flexibility, and role-based access ensure efficient management across departments.
Crafted for robust firewall and network security, Juniper vSRX provides effective intrusion prevention, VPN functionalities, and traffic management. Its high-performance architecture handles large traffic volumes, and offerings such as application filtering and graphical interface enhance user operations. Although there is feedback on outdated GUI and scalability issues during high traffic, the benefits of flexibility and ease of deployment remain. Licensing complexities and cloud integration pose challenges, yet its abilities in server protection and supporting geographically diverse operations through IP VPN tunnels are advantageous.

WatchGuard Firebox is a high-performance firewall known for its ease of setup, offering robust security with layered protection and centralized management capabilities.
WatchGuard Firebox stands out for its intuitive management and high throughput, addressing security needs with features like VPN, web filtering, and threat detection. Its centralized control and reporting abilities, along with Active Directory integration, make it popular among varied organizations. Its user-friendly interface and ongoing updates enhance usability and reliability. However, there's a call for better cloud-based administration, scalability, and improved integration with third-party vendors.
